Solid Tantalum Chip Capacitors
M
ICROTAN®
DLA Approved, Leadframeless Molded
FEATURES
• High reliability solid surface mount tantalum
capacitors
• Terminations: Gold plated; tin/lead solder
plated
• Reliability Grade: Weibull B per MIL-PRF-55365
• Low DCL for extended battery life
• Small sizes for space constrained applications
• L-shaped terminations for superior board mounting
• Material categorization: For definitions of compliance
please see
www.vishay.com/doc?99912
PERFORMANCE/ELECTRICAL CHARACTERISTICS
Operating Temperature:
- 55 °C to + 125 °C
(above 85 °C, voltage derating is required)
Capacitance Range:
1 μF to 47 μF
Capacitance Tolerance:
± 10 %; ± 20 %
Voltage Range:
6.3 V
DC
to 40 V
DC
